Output aca423bbf174fc938b59a03de9922a903d33fd3073936453721c8f1cb3736ce7:0

value
35443383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e3c66b7f04b1d71caf1afad0d00e0154aba2be9 OP_EQUAL
address
32zHjysgTKAr9zdFjChdtUNrHA3G6NAhR4
transaction
aca423bbf174fc938b59a03de9922a903d33fd3073936453721c8f1cb3736ce7
confirmations
335040
spent
true